Add 30/54 and 15/42
30/54 + 15/42 is 115/126.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 54 and 42 is 378
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 378 - For the 1st fraction, since 54 × 7 = 378,
30/54 = 30 × 7/54 × 7 = 210/378 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 42 × 9 = 378,
15/42 = 15 × 9/42 × 9 = 135/378 - Add the two like fractions:
210/378 + 135/378 = 210 + 135/378 = 345/378 - 345/378 simplified gives 115/126
- So, 30/54 + 15/42 = 115/126
